top of page

Mount Hermon and the Origin of the Giants

Updated: Mar 10

Video from Shema Yisrael

Mount Hermon and the Origin of the Giants

"In this video Todd takes us on location in the Land of Israel to the region of Bashan on the Golan Heights near Mount Hermon to talk about the Watchers and the Nephilim mentioned in 1 Enoch and Genesis 6. We are committed to spreading the Good News of Yahushua to all the nations. The time it takes to write, edit, produce, publish, print, distribute and translate these materials is enormous. If you have found this work to be beneficial, please consider making a contribution. We appreciate help from individuals who find value in this work." from video introduction.

19 views0 comments


bottom of page